Output 93fdec9ca331614aef833f8067cca1e6607dc9c2b3ea09de0ff5e2d0bb2e0554:0

value
85148687
script pubkey
OP_0 OP_PUSHBYTES_20 7c87b49bf10ec54ab5d430b68c9f46fff32ae6d9
address
ltc1q0jrmfxl3pmz54dw5xzmge86xllej4ekewyexc3
transaction
93fdec9ca331614aef833f8067cca1e6607dc9c2b3ea09de0ff5e2d0bb2e0554
spent
true